Local tips
- Visit early in the morning or late afternoon for the best lighting for photography.
- Wear sturdy footwear as some trails can be steep and rocky.
- Check the weather forecast before you go, as conditions can change rapidly in the area.
- Bring water and snacks, especially if you plan to hike longer trails.
- Explore nearby walking paths to experience more of Arran's stunning scenery.
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ving, head towards the village of Lamlash and take the A841 road. Continue on the A841 for approximately 6 miles. Look for signs indicating 'Devils Punch Bowl' as you approach the area. The car park for the Devils Punch Bowl is located at the end of a small lane off the A841. The parking is free but limited, so arrive early during peak times.
-
Public Transportation
Take the local bus service from Brodick to Lamlash. The bus journey takes about 15 minutes. Alight at Lamlash and then transfer to the Arran Community Transport service, which operates a route to the Devils Punch Bowl. The community transport service may require prior booking, so check their schedule in advance. There may be a small fare for this service, typically around £3-£5.
-
Walking
If you are staying nearby in Lamlash or another close village, consider walking to the Devils Punch Bowl. From Lamlash, it's approximately a 1.5-mile walk. Follow the A841 road towards the north and look for signs leading to the walking path to the Devils Punch Bowl. Note that the path can be steep in places, so wear appropriate footwear.
